Knock Sensor: Testing and Inspection




KNOCK SENSOR

The knock sensor is attached to the cylinder block and senses engine knocking conditions. A knocking vibration from the cylinder block is applied as pressure to the piezoelectric element. This vibrational pressure is then converted into a voltage signal which is delivered as output. If engine knocking occurs, ignition timing is retarded to suppress it.

SENSOR INSPECTION
1. Disconnect the knock sensor connector.
2. Measure resistance between the terminal 2 and 3.
Standard value: about 5 MOhm [at 20 °C (68 °F)]

3. If the resistance is continual, replace the knock sensor.
Knock sensor: 16 - 28 Nm (160 - 250 kg.cm, 11.8 - 18.4 lb.ft)




4. Measure the capacitance between the terminal 2 and 3.
Standard value : 800 - 1600 pF
